Then your friends haven't heard of speed clear teams. These "elite" teams, consisting of all-human players, can clear the whole Underworld in an average of 25 mins. Try achieving even near that with a heroes team, you can't. Very few players even have the skills to successfully clear UW with a full heroes teams (you need to micro-manage them for that) yet a SC team does it so easily with human players so how can you say heroes are more powerful? Human players are obviously more powerful.
